Popular Vocational Courses in Dehradun
1. Food & Beverage (F&B) Service Training
- Skills Taught:
- Table setup, customer service, hygiene management.
- Career Opportunities:
- Waiter, Banquet Assistant, Café Staff.
- Why It’s Popular:
- Dehradun’s thriving hospitality sector offers numerous opportunities for F&B professionals.
2. Tailoring and Stitching
- Skills Taught:
- Stitching, embroidery, garment construction.
- Career Opportunities:
- Tailor, Boutique Assistant, Textile Worker.
- Why It’s Popular:
- Empowers women to earn through home-based businesses or local boutiques.
3. Commis Chef Training
- Skills Taught:
- Food preparation, basic cooking, inventory management.
- Career Opportunities:
- Kitchen Assistant, Junior Chef, Bakery Helper.
- Why It’s Popular:
- Addresses the growing demand for skilled chefs in restaurants and hotels.
4. Office Support and Data Entry
- Skills Taught:
- Typing, filing, data management.
- Career Opportunities:
- Office Assistant, Data Entry Operator, Clerk.
- Why It’s Popular:
- Prepares students for administrative roles in businesses and organizations.
